How far people went at school, the qualifications they hold and what they studied.
Just 4.5% of adults in Coonambula hold a bachelor degree or higher, which is far below the national figure. This reflects a community where most people have focused on practical skills rather than university studies. High school completion is also much lower than in most other areas.
Highest year of school completed.
Only 40.7% of residents finished Year 12, a figure far below both the Queensland and Australian averages. Many residents left school earlier, with 39% completing Year 10 and 13.6% finishing Year 9 or below.

Post-school qualifications and degrees.
Qualifications are mostly practical, with 44.4% of people holding a Certificate III or IV. This helps explain why the number of people with university degrees is much lower than in most other areas.

What people studied.
Those with qualifications often studied trade and technical fields, with architecture and building being the most common at 16.7%, followed by engineering at 13.9%.
